Secret Assessment Methods

Utilizing a variety of evaluation strategies is crucial for making certain the honesty of welds in pipe systems. Amongst one of the most noticeable approaches are visual evaluation, ultrasonic screening (UT), radiographic screening (RT), and magnetic bit screening (MT) Each technique serves a distinct objective and is fit to particular sorts of welds and materials.


Aesthetic evaluation, frequently the very first line of protection, enables the identification of surface problems such as fractures, damages, and porosity. Ultrasonic screening employs high-frequency acoustic waves to detect internal problems, supplying a complete evaluation of weld honesty. This non-destructive method is particularly reliable for determining discontinuities that may not be noticeable on the surface area.




Radiographic screening includes making use of X-rays or gamma rays to generate images of the welded joint, revealing interior issues. This strategy supplies in-depth understandings but might need specialized tools and safety and security factors to consider. Lastly, magnetic particle screening works for finding surface area and near-surface interruptions in ferromagnetic materials, using magnetic fields and great iron particles.




Sector Standards and Regulations





Compliance with sector standards and policies is vital for guaranteeing the high quality and safety and security of pipe welding examinations. These requirements provide a structure for ideal techniques in welding procedures, materials, and examination strategies, enabling organizations to minimize problems and boost the stability of pipe systems. Secret bodies such as the American Society of Mechanical Designers (ASME), the American Welding Society (AWS), and the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) state standards that are widely acknowledged and taken on within the market.


In the USA, laws from the Pipe and Hazardous Materials see this website Safety And Security Management (PHMSA) control the safety and security of pipeline procedures, mandating rigorous evaluation procedures. These criteria not only offer to protect public safety and security and the atmosphere yet likewise guarantee conformity with legal and legal obligations. Adherence to the relevant codes, such as ASME B31.3 for procedure piping, is essential for preserving operational performance and governing conformity.


Furthermore, continuous updates and modifications to these criteria mirror technological innovations and developing sector practices, emphasizing the requirement for companies to remain educated and train workers as necessary. Inevitably, durable image source conformity with recognized criteria fosters trust and reliability in pipe framework, safeguarding both possessions and stakeholders.


Reliable Examination Treatments



Reliable evaluation treatments are vital for determining potential problems in pipe welds and making sure the overall honesty of the system. A methodical method to evaluation includes several crucial stages, including pre-weld, in-process, and post-weld assessments. Each stage plays an essential duty in maintaining top quality assurance.


Throughout pre-weld evaluation, it is necessary to evaluate the products and joint arrangements, guaranteeing compliance with job specs. In-process inspections include monitoring welding methods and criteria, such as warmth input and travel rate, to stop flaws from taking place. This stage permits real-time modifications to welding practices.


Post-weld examinations include non-destructive testing (NDT) methods like radiography, ultrasonic screening, and magnetic bit screening. These approaches assist detect internal and surface area defects that could jeopardize the pipe's capability. Paperwork of all examination activities is paramount, giving a traceable record that sustains conformity with industry requirements.


Educating and accreditation of assessment employees additionally improve the effectiveness of these procedures. By adhering to an organized assessment procedure, companies can alleviate dangers, guarantee conformity, and ultimately provide pipes that fulfill strict safety and efficiency requirements.
